Here’s what you need to know about your coffee

  • A new research has shown that people who drink four cups of coffee or more have a whopping 64% lower risk of early death than those who do not drink coffee at all.
  • Coffee was previously pointed out as the cause of diseases because researchers had not isolated other behaviors from the study such as smoking, drinking and a sedentary lifestyle.
  • New research shows that coffee in fact, reduces your risk of diabetes, stroke, liver disease, Alzheimer’s and cognitive issues such as depression
  • Health benefits of coffee include antioxidants and ant-inflammatory properties
  • It can help you lose weight! That’s what we want to hear. Coffee can actually increase your metabolic rate resulting in weight loss
  • It helps your physical performance and increases energy levels. The caffeine present in coffee stimulates your nervous system and increases adrenaline levels. So have a cup of coffee 30 minutes prior to your workout and see if you notice a difference in your energy levels
  • Just because coffee seems to be healthy, doesn’t mean it remains so after adding in creamers, 2 sugars and a shot of caramel. Try using healthy alternatives such as honey and organic milk to get the maximum benefits from your cup of coffee

Also, do try to use good quality coffee as not all brands are good for you. Be informed and aware of what is going inside your body for the maximum health benefits.
